Prepared for sales leads ahead of Thursday's review: Quillan Dynamics is assessing the acquisition of Marrow & Fayle, a regional distributor with strong coverage in the Ostbridge corridor. The deal would shorten delivery times and add roughly forty active accounts. Integration risk is rated moderate; channel conflict is the main concern raised so far. Please come prepared to discuss account overlap in your territories. Final terms remain under negotiation. The strategic rationale is captured in the confidential note below.

internal memo for hahif-hahaf: Headcount on the Zorwyn team goes from 9 to 100 by the end of October. Gross margin on Zorwyn came in at 5 percent against a plan of 10 percent.

Handover: Crowbill user-module split

To plugin authors: the user module is now a standalone service, out of the monolith as of this week. Auth hooks moved with it; old in-process extension points are gone. Adapt plugins to the new RPC surface before the deprecation window closes. The service's current runtime configuration follows below.

config for tawif-bagef:
[sorwyn]
team = sorys
access_code = ac_9ba40c
host = sorwyn.ordingrid.local
port = 5000
owner = aldok.quenion
peer = belath.paliqcloud.local

## Schema Registry Runbook

Plugin authors publish event schemas to Vexhall Registry before shipping. Register via `vex schema push`. Schemas are validated against compatibility mode BACKWARD; breaking changes are rejected. Versions are immutable once published. Deprecate old versions with `vex schema retire` — never delete. The registry CLI reads config from `~/.vexrc`. For local testing, run the registry in standalone mode, which requires direct access to the metadata store via this connection string.

replica DSN, yahaf-yagaf: mongodb://tamath_svc:a2netSk3RZMuTj@db-d084.novacsoft.internal:5432/ralmir